Webb11 dec. 2024 · Histogram equalization consists of this distribution of grey levels in a new but uniform distribution. The purpose of histogram equalization is to obtain a uniform distribution of grey levels and the resulting image will show an improvement in contrast. Uniform Histogram. The data that is extremely compatible is represented by a uniform histogram.
WebbWhat is uniform histogram? Uniform: A uniform shaped histogram indicates data that is very consistent; the frequency of each class is very similar to that of the others. A data set with a uniform-shaped histogram may be multimodal – the having multiple intervals with the maximum frequency. ← Previous Post Next Post → WebbSymmetric histogram, more popularly known as the bell shaped histogram, is named after its structure. It is such that there appears to be a centre and all the values are surrounding it continuously. As we move towards the sides from the centre, the value seems to be decreasing. A bell shaped histogram represents normal distribution.
